If you worked for DoorDash in multiple states, you may (depending on the states and their tax laws), have to file multiple state tax returns. This process is fairly straightforward in TurboTax.

 

Every state wants its share of your income, which means you may owe taxes to multiple states depending on your circumstances. Living or working in two or more states doesn't affect your federal tax return. However, you may have to navigate through filing multiple state tax returns.

 

You would likely have to file a non-resident state tax return in the states that you work in other than Texas, provided they have a state income tax.

 

Doordash seems fairly simple to work for in multiple states. You would have to update your location in the app or contact support if you plan to dash in a different state or one where you are not listed as living. 

 

The only limitation is that you cannot dash outside of the country where you reside.


You would receive a Form 1099-NEC from DoorDash. You will report this on your Federal Tax return as self-employment income on Form Schedule C. You will be able to deduct your ordinary and necessary business expenses and mileage against your income. If you make over $400, you will have to pay self-employment tax on your income. 

 

You should keep an accurate record of your expenses and mileage so you can complete your taxes and properly report your ordinary and necessary business expenses.
